Etymology

The name ‘Imru’ is derived from the Harari word ‘imra’, which means ‘good’ or ‘virtuous’.

Linguistic family: Afro-Asiatic > Semitic > South Semitic > Ethiopian Semitic

Cultural context

In Harari culture, names often reflect desirable qualities or aspirations for the child’s future. ‘Imru’ is a name that conveys the hope for the child to embody goodness and virtue.

Symbolism

The name symbolises the virtues of goodness and moral integrity, reflecting the cultural values of the Harari people.
